Odo : [Odo is investigating the death of the drunk Klingon Kozak] Alright Quark, start from the beginning.
Rom : [very quickly; having been told by Quark to lie] My brother fought a desperate hand-to-hand battle with the Klingon, and was forced to kill it in self-defense!
Odo : [narrowing his eyes on Quark; incredulous] *You*... killed him?
Quark : [to Odo, and the crowd of bystanders waiting outside] I had no choice. He was abusive, vulgar - a typical drunken Klingon. All that was fine until it was time to pay his bill. He refused. I insisted. We began to argue. He pushed me! *I* pushed back! I was about to call for security to throw him out of my bar, until suddenly he pulls a knife on me!
[crowd gasps]
Quark : [continuing with his "story"] I avoided the first thrust. He came at me again... I hit him, with a left jab. There was furious exchange of blows. The next thing I knew, his knife was at my throat! So... I twisted it out of his grasp... and plunged it into his chest!
[Crowd gasps in astonishment. Quark breathes heavily, as if reliving the "event" disturbs him]
Quark : I will never forget the look on his face as his life drained away... I rather not talk about this anymore.
[Quark walks away]
